We're now seeking an experienced Full Stack Cybersecurity Incident Responder to join our team and help us achieve our goals. **Job Summary:** As a Full Stack Cybersecurity Incident Responder at arenaflex, you will be responsible for leading the response efforts for the entire lifecycle of security incidents, from occurrence identification to recovery and prevention. You will work closely with our Global IT team to develop and implement incident response plans, conduct thorough investigations, and provide expert analysis to senior leadership and incident response teams. Your expertise will be instrumental in driving the development and improvement of our IR program, including the integration of cutting-edge technologies and best practices. **Responsibilities:** * Lead incident response efforts for the entire lifecycle of security incidents, including occurrence identification, assessment, containment, eradication, recovery, and documentation * Conduct thorough investigations of security incidents, including malware analysis, threat hunting, and digital forensics * Collaborate with our Global IT team to develop and implement incident response plans, including the integration of new technologies and best practices * Provide expert analysis and recommendations to senior leadership and incident response teams on incident response strategies and tactics * Develop and maintain relationships with external vendors and partners to ensure the availability of specialized expertise and resources * Stay up-to-date with emerging threats and technologies, and provide recommendations for the improvement of our IR program * Collaborate with our SOC Examiners and Incident Response Teams to develop and conduct tabletop exercises and simulation scenarios to identify areas for improvement and optimize incident response processes * Work closely with our SIEM Designing team to improve telemetry and visibility for incident detection and analysis **Requirements:** *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Cybersecurity, or a related field * 3+ years of experience in incident response, malware analysis, and digital forensics * Proven expertise in security incident management strategies throughout the entire lifecycle, including evaluation, control, recovery, documentation, evidence protection, and legal sciences * Experience performing in-depth digital forensic examinations of mobile devices, laptops, workstations, tablets, and other digital media * High-level working experience with at least one digital forensic tool (e.g., EnCase, FTK, etc.) * Strong experience in malware identification, malware analysis, and reverse engineering of malicious code * Broad experience with EDR technologies, malicious code analysis, packet capture analysis, identifying indicators of compromise (IOC), threat analysis, anomaly detection, advanced firewalls (NGFW), security incident and event management (SIEM) technologies, and vulnerability assessment tools * Strong understanding of networking, operating system platforms, database management systems, cloud, and hosting services *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to convey complex technical concepts to both technical and non-technical audiences * Working knowledge of compliance and regulatory requirements for SOX, PCI, GDPR, and other relevant standards **Preferred Qualifications:** * Four-year degree or equivalent experience in Cybersecurity, Data Science, Data Analytics, or a related field * 4+ years of experience in incident response, malware analysis, and digital forensics * Certifications such as CISSP or equivalent * Experience with cloud-based security platforms and services * Strong experience with threat intelligence and threat hunting **What We Offer:** * Competitive salary and benefits package * Opportunity to work with a leading company in the cybersecurity industry * Collaborative and dynamic work environment * Professional development and growth opportunities * Flexible work arrangements, including remote work options * Access to cutting-edge technologies and tools * Recognition and rewards for outstanding performance **How to Apply:** If you're a motivated and experienced cybersecurity professional looking for a new challenge, please submit your application, including your resume and a cover letter, to [arenaflex Careers Page]( We can't wait to hear from you!
